Job Description Quality Assurance Manager

The Manager, Quality Assurance manages the PPU support unit services of the QA department and oversees setting accurate schedules and resources. The role involves performing Quality Assurance activities with minimal supervision, supporting corporate Quality Systems and client procedures, including document management, batch record review, QC data, SOPs, material and final product releases, and assisting Quality management with departmental needs.

The ideal candidate exercises judgment within generally defined practices and policies, implements ongoing quality improvement processes with interdepartmental teams, and develops quality assurance metrics for performance enhancement. The manager anticipates program release issues, takes corrective actions, and collaborates with project managers on schedules and resource allocation for QA projects, software deployment, customer integration, and validation activities.

The QA Manager will delegate responsibilities to direct reports (QA Associate I, II, and III), support manufacturing processes, ensure the safe release of cellular products per HCATs and client requirements, and promote compliance with CGMP and GTP regulations and SOPs. Responsibilities include establishing documentation policies, authoring and reviewing SOPs, managing batch records and deviations, controlling lot numbers, overseeing nonconformance dispositions, investigating deviations, and implementing corrective actions.

The role involves interfacing with suppliers and production personnel, monitoring corrective actions, supporting investigations, providing quality metrics, hosting client audits, and training staff on QSR, ISO, and company quality systems. The manager will also mentor the QA team, lead the implementation of Quality Agreements, and maintain compliance.

REQUIREMENTS

  • BS Degree in biological sciences or equivalent.
  • Minimum 5-10 years of experience in the pharmaceutical or biologics industry.
  • Understanding of cGMPs and GLPs.
  • Knowledge of laboratory operations, equipment, validation, and aseptic processing.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, Visio, Microsoft Project, and Excel.
  • Excellent organizational, communication, and team skills.
  • Ability to travel and adapt to evolving responsibilities.
